Disability shower installation services involve modifying or replacing existing showers to improve accessibility and safety for individuals with mobility challenges. These services typically include installing walk-in showers, low-threshold entryways, grab bars, and non-slip flooring to create a more user-friendly bathing environment. The goal is to make showering easier and safer, especially for those who may have difficulty stepping over high tub walls or maneuvering in traditional shower setups. Local contractors experienced in disability bathroom modifications can assess a property’s layout and recommend practical solutions tailored to individual needs.
This type of service helps address common problems such as difficulty entering or exiting standard showers, risk of slips and falls, and limited mobility during bathing. For seniors, individuals recovering from injuries, or those with disabilities, traditional showers can pose significant safety hazards. Installing accessible features can reduce the risk of accidents and provide greater independence in daily routines. The overview below groups typical Disability Shower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Princeton, NJ.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or modifications or repairs to existing shower setups in Princeton, NJ, range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, though prices can vary based on specific needs and materials used.
Full Shower Replacement - Replacing an entire shower unit generally costs between $1,200 and $3,500. Larger, more complex projects, such as custom installations, can reach $4,500 or more, but most projects stay within the mid-tier range.
Accessibility Modifications - Installing accessible features like grab bars or low-threshold entries typically costs between $500 and $2,000. These projects are often straightforward, with fewer that push into the higher cost brackets.
Custom or Luxury Installations - High-end, custom-designed showers can cost $4,000 to $8,000 or more, depending on design complexity and materials. While fewer projects fall into this tier, local contractors can accommodate these more elaborate need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
